I like these compared to the pros and plus, its nice not having any inner ear pressure once youve got the hang of how they go in your ear. Battery not as good as plus though. At low volume you can hear around you but not fully. ANC is non existent it will only quiet low hums that you didnt notice were there until there gone. Hope that makes sense. I can wear these the longest out of all three for sure though
